The Science Behind Sleep and Mood Connection
Your brain processes emotions during sleep, particularly during REM stages. Insufficient or disrupted sleep prevents this emotional processing, leaving you vulnerable to mood swings and heightened stress responses. The prefrontal cortex, responsible for rational thinking and emotional control, becomes less active after poor sleep, while the amygdala—your brain’s alarm system—becomes hyperactive.
This biological reality explains why everything feels harder after a bad night’s sleep. Total Sleep Time: Finding Your Personal Sweet Spot
While seven to nine hours represents the general recommendation for adults, your optimal sleep duration is individual. Total sleep time serves as your baseline KPI—the foundation upon which other metrics build. Track your sleep duration alongside your next-day mood and energy to identify your personal requirement.
Some people thrive on seven hours, while others need nine to feel their best. The key is consistency. Irregular sleep duration disrupts your circadian rhythm, leading to that perpetual jet-lag feeling even when you’re home. Aim for variation of no more than 30 minutes between weekdays and weekends.
Sleep Efficiency: Quality Over Quantity
Sleep efficiency measures the percentage of time you spend actually sleeping versus lying in bed. A sleep efficiency of 85% or higher indicates healthy sleep. If you spend eight hours in bed but only sleep six hours, your efficiency is 75%—suggesting room for improvement.
Low sleep efficiency often signals stress, environmental issues, or poor sleep hygiene. This metric directly impacts how refreshed you feel because fragmented rest prevents your brain from completing full sleep cycles. Improving this single KPI can dramatically boost your energy levels without increasing time in bed.
Sleep Latency: How Quickly You Fall Asleep
Sleep latency refers to the time between lying down and falling asleep. Healthy sleep latency ranges from 10 to 20 minutes. Falling asleep in under five minutes typically indicates sleep deprivation, while consistently taking over 30 minutes suggests difficulties that need addressing.
This KPI reveals your sleep pressure—the biological drive to sleep. When optimized, you feel pleasantly drowsy at bedtime but alert during the day. Monitoring this metric helps you fine-tune your sleep schedule and evening routine for effortless transitions into rest.
REM and Deep Sleep Percentages: The Restoration Zones
Your sleep cycles through different stages, each serving unique functions. Deep sleep (slow-wave sleep) handles physical restoration, immune function, and memory consolidation. REM sleep processes emotions, supports learning, and maintains psychological health.
Healthy adults typically spend 20-25% of sleep in REM and 15-20% in deep sleep. When these percentages drop, you wake feeling unrested despite adequate total sleep time. Low REM sleep particularly affects mood stability and creative thinking, while insufficient deep sleep impacts physical energy and recovery.
Sleep Consistency: The Underrated Game-Changer
Perhaps the most overlooked yet powerful KPI is sleep consistency—maintaining regular bed and wake times. Your circadian rhythm thrives on predictability. Even with excellent sleep quality, irregular timing creates internal confusion similar to constantly switching time zones.
Research shows that sleep consistency predicts daytime functioning better than sleep duration alone. Going to bed within 30 minutes of the same time nightly and waking at consistent times—even on weekends—strengthens your circadian rhythm, making both sleep and wakefulness feel more natural and energizing.
💡 Tracking Your Sleep KPIs Without Obsession
The goal of monitoring sleep metrics is insight, not anxiety. Over-focusing on numbers can paradoxically worsen sleep quality through a phenomenon called orthosomnia—obsessive perfectionism about sleep data. The right approach balances awareness with flexibility.
Choosing Your Tracking Method
Multiple tools exist for monitoring sleep KPIs, from sophisticated wearables to simple sleep diary apps. Wearable devices like fitness trackers and smartwatches use movement and heart rate to estimate sleep stages with reasonable accuracy. While not as precise as laboratory polysomnography, they provide valuable trends and patterns.
Sleep tracking apps that use your smartphone’s sensors offer a budget-friendly alternative. These typically require placing your phone on the mattress to detect movement patterns. Some apps also incorporate sound recording to identify snoring or environmental disturbances.
For those preferring low-tech options, a simple sleep journal tracking bedtime, wake time, sleep quality rating, and next-day energy creates valuable insights. The best tracking method is the one you’ll consistently use without it disrupting your sleep routine.
Interpreting Patterns, Not Individual Nights
One poor night’s data means little. Sleep KPIs reveal their value through weekly and monthly patterns. Track your metrics for at least two weeks before drawing conclusions. Look for trends rather than fixating on nightly variations.
Notice correlations between behaviors and outcomes. Does your REM sleep suffer after evening alcohol? Does sleep efficiency improve when you read instead of scrolling? These personal patterns matter more than whether you hit theoretical targets every night.

Enhancing Sleep Efficiency Through Environment
Your sleep environment dramatically affects efficiency. Temperature represents the most underestimated factor—optimal bedroom temperature ranges from 60-67°F (15-19°C). Your core body temperature needs to drop for sleep initiation, and a cool room facilitates this biological requirement.
Darkness matters equally. Even small amounts of light disrupt circadian signaling and reduce sleep quality. Use blackout curtains or a comfortable sleep mask. Remove or cover LED lights from electronics, as even these tiny sources can affect melatonin production.
Sound management completes the environmental trinity. Consistent background noise often works better than silence, masking disruptive sounds. White noise machines, fans, or nature sound apps create acoustic consistency that supports uninterrupted sleep.
Improving Sleep Latency With a Wind-Down Protocol
Your pre-sleep routine directly influences how quickly you fall asleep. Create a consistent 60-90 minute wind-down period that signals your body to prepare for rest. This buffer zone transitions your nervous system from active to parasympathetic dominance.
Dim lights throughout your home during this period. Bright light suppresses melatonin, your sleep hormone. Use amber or red-spectrum lighting if possible. Avoid screens or use blue light filters, though complete screen avoidance works best for those struggling with sleep latency.
Incorporate relaxing activities that work for your personality. Progressive muscle relaxation, gentle stretching, reading physical books, or listening to calming music all support sleep preparation. The specific activity matters less than consistency and genuine relaxation.
Maximizing REM and Deep Sleep Percentages
Both REM and deep sleep respond to specific lifestyle factors. Alcohol severely disrupts REM sleep architecture, even in moderate amounts. While it may hasten sleep onset, it fragments sleep cycles and reduces restorative value. Limiting alcohol, especially within four hours of bedtime, protects REM sleep.
Deep sleep responds positively to physical activity, but timing matters. Vigorous exercise too close to bedtime can interfere with sleep onset. Morning or afternoon workouts optimize deep sleep without compromising sleep latency. Even moderate daily movement significantly improves slow-wave sleep percentages.
Stress management profoundly affects both sleep stages. Chronic stress elevates cortisol, which inhibits deep sleep and can cause premature REM awakening. Daily stress reduction practices—meditation, journaling, time in nature—support healthier sleep architecture beyond just their immediate calming effects.
Building Unshakeable Sleep Consistency
Consistency requires protecting both ends of your sleep schedule. Set a non-negotiable wake time, even on weekends. This anchor point stabilizes your circadian rhythm. Your sleep drive naturally builds across the day, making bedtime progressively easier as consistency develops.
Use morning light exposure to reinforce your wake time. Sunlight within 30 minutes of waking powerfully sets your circadian clock. Even on cloudy days, outdoor light intensity far exceeds indoor lighting. This simple habit strengthens your sleep-wake cycle from the beginning of your day.
When life inevitably disrupts your schedule, return to consistency quickly. One late night shouldn’t derail your entire week. Resist the urge to dramatically shift your schedule to “catch up.” Instead, maintain your regular wake time and allow increased sleep pressure to naturally restore your rhythm.

🎯 Creating Your Personal Sleep KPI Action Plan
Knowledge becomes power only through application. Create a practical, personalized approach to leveraging sleep KPIs for better days. Start small—attempting too many changes simultaneously often leads to abandonment rather than sustainable improvement.
Week One: Establish Your Baseline
Begin by simply tracking without changing anything. Observe your current sleep KPIs, noting patterns and correlations. Record how you feel each day, creating connections between sleep metrics and daytime experience. This baseline provides your starting point and helps identify which KPIs need attention most urgently.
Week Two: Choose One KPI to Target
Select the metric that appears most problematic or offers the greatest improvement opportunity. If your sleep efficiency is low, focus there. If consistency varies wildly, make regular timing your priority. Implement one or two specific strategies targeting that KPI while continuing to track all metrics.
Week Three and Beyond: Iterate and Expand
Assess your chosen intervention’s impact. Has your target KPI improved? More importantly, do you feel better? If progress is evident, maintain those changes while potentially adding another focus area. If results disappoint, adjust your approach or try different strategies for the same KPI.
